Skip to content

Commit 3d39117

Browse files
committed
Add TruffleRuby and TruffleRuby GraalVM 33.0.1
1 parent 10ea767 commit 3d39117

File tree

2 files changed

+38
-0
lines changed

2 files changed

+38
-0
lines changed
Lines changed: 19 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,19 @@
1+
platform="$(uname -s)-$(uname -m)"
2+
case $platform in
3+
Linux-x86_64)
4+
install_package "truffleruby+graalvm-33.0.1" "https://github.com/truffleruby/truffleruby/releases/download/graal-33.0.1/truffleruby-jvm-33.0.1-linux-amd64.tar.gz#069496650feca524bb50d862f95210c8031ac1a4a1c6dcbef6b8f8429ec1ec37" truffleruby
5+
;;
6+
Linux-aarch64)
7+
install_package "truffleruby+graalvm-33.0.1" "https://github.com/truffleruby/truffleruby/releases/download/graal-33.0.1/truffleruby-jvm-33.0.1-linux-aarch64.tar.gz#a35f8b73d3b02244f47e2c3e4fa2920e7aff8e4c9cb4192a3f3b6e3efa09f1c4" truffleruby
8+
;;
9+
Darwin-x86_64)
10+
install_package "truffleruby+graalvm-33.0.1" "https://github.com/truffleruby/truffleruby/releases/download/graal-33.0.1/truffleruby-jvm-33.0.1-macos-amd64.tar.gz#c48b41061443397e1ddf2e59934cd0b445ad506b5d64e91a608f45d44246d9a4" truffleruby
11+
;;
12+
Darwin-arm64)
13+
install_package "truffleruby+graalvm-33.0.1" "https://github.com/truffleruby/truffleruby/releases/download/graal-33.0.1/truffleruby-jvm-33.0.1-macos-aarch64.tar.gz#660bd3daaae181707fcf7bbfa87b985299354956b0e23ec7d6405373dc44010b" truffleruby
14+
;;
15+
*)
16+
colorize 1 "Unsupported platform: $platform"
17+
return 1
18+
;;
19+
esac
Lines changed: 19 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,19 @@
1+
platform="$(uname -s)-$(uname -m)"
2+
case $platform in
3+
Linux-x86_64)
4+
install_package "truffleruby-33.0.1" "https://github.com/truffleruby/truffleruby/releases/download/graal-33.0.1/truffleruby-33.0.1-linux-amd64.tar.gz#f20e5f7796501ddf52ab978d6987dbd6c941c347b5d9cb06be6e21b4aa51005f" truffleruby
5+
;;
6+
Linux-aarch64)
7+
install_package "truffleruby-33.0.1" "https://github.com/truffleruby/truffleruby/releases/download/graal-33.0.1/truffleruby-33.0.1-linux-aarch64.tar.gz#7b2a32a6e0b9e52b9969a9488ae2e11ae6a0369c1bba00fc9703985b08ab00b7" truffleruby
8+
;;
9+
Darwin-x86_64)
10+
install_package "truffleruby-33.0.1" "https://github.com/truffleruby/truffleruby/releases/download/graal-33.0.1/truffleruby-33.0.1-macos-amd64.tar.gz#fdb29ca55b2e8f8a56c6199a84478bd65be0507f7d0898ad64bdc684025b01c6" truffleruby
11+
;;
12+
Darwin-arm64)
13+
install_package "truffleruby-33.0.1" "https://github.com/truffleruby/truffleruby/releases/download/graal-33.0.1/truffleruby-33.0.1-macos-aarch64.tar.gz#a84f9da803f4f125be4c5d49bb1d45fee2985362054997291ba264f825b3cbcd" truffleruby
14+
;;
15+
*)
16+
colorize 1 "Unsupported platform: $platform"
17+
return 1
18+
;;
19+
esac

0 commit comments

Comments
 (0)